Heuveloord and Rotsoord keeps surprising us with cool new spots. We’re starting off 2017 well with the new Cafe Brutal, located under the water tower on the Vaartsche Rijn. By now the restaurant WT Urban Kitchen has reached ‘rockstar status’, but not everyone knew about the cosy cafe under it. But that’ll change this year, because Cafe Brutal just opened its doors and promises delicious Spanish wines and bites.
Wine on the scale
On the menu you’ll find good Spanish wines, snacks, and Iberian ham. Cafe Brutal is doing things a bit differently, serving wine not by the glass but by the bottle. Can’t finish the bottle? They’ll weigh it for you and you’ll only pay for what you drank. Quite cheeky and simple! We can already recommend the Rioja – a delicious, full-bodied red wine that complements the fresh Iberian ham nicely. The well-known Spanish tomato sauce has a bite, and the aioli is creamy and full of flavour. Put this on your agenda: a whole evening of dipping delicious crunchy breadsticks, drinking wine, and general cosiness!
Cafe Brutal offers a wine & food combo for 27.50. You get a bottle of house wine and a platter of Iberian charcuterie. With prices like this, you could go out for drinks every night!
Awesome terrace
Last year, I loved spending time on the terrace of the water tower on the Vaartsche Rijn. It’s a unique bit of Utrecht where you can watch boats sail by while you enjoy a drink & a snack. With the sun on your head in the summer, or under a heat lamp in the colder months, it’s definitely a great place to linger.
